"""
TensorRT Custom Build Backend
A PEP 517 compliant build backend that wraps setuptools to provide:
1. Custom wheel tag support (python-tag, plat-name) via CLI config settings
2. Dynamic package naming based on wheel type (standalone, libs, frontend, etc.)
This backend reads configuration from [tool.tensorrt] in pyproject.toml and
computes the appropriate package names based on the wheel-type config setting
passed via the build frontend CLI.
Usage in pyproject.toml:
[build-system]
requires = ["setuptools>=61.0", "wheel"]
build-backend = "tensorrt_build_backend"
backend-path = ["."]
[tool.tensorrt]
base-name = "tensorrt" # Base module name
cuda-major = "12" # CUDA major version
Config settings (passed via `python -m build --config-setting=key=value`):
wheel-type: Type of wheel being built. One of:
- "binding": Non-standalone bindings (name = base-name)
- "binding_standalone": Standalone bindings (name = {base-name}_cu{cuda}_bindings)
- "libs": Libraries wheel (name = {base-name}_cu{cuda}_libs)
- "frontend": Frontend/metapackage (name = {base-name}_cu{cuda})
python-tag: Python tag for the wheel (e.g., "cp312")
plat-name: Platform tag for the wheel (e.g., "linux_x86_64")
"""
import shutil
import tempfile
from pathlib import Path
try:
import tomllib
except ImportError:
import tomli as tomllib
from setuptools.build_meta import (
build_sdist,
get_requires_for_build_sdist,
get_requires_for_build_wheel,
prepare_metadata_for_build_wheel,
)
from setuptools.build_meta import build_wheel as _setuptools_build_wheel
def _read_pyproject_toml():
"""Read and parse pyproject.toml from the current directory."""
pyproject_path = Path("pyproject.toml")
if not pyproject_path.exists():
return {}
with open(pyproject_path, "rb") as f:
return tomllib.load(f)
def _get_tensorrt_config():
"""
Get TensorRT-specific configuration from pyproject.toml.
Returns a dict with keys:
- base_name: Base module name (e.g., "tensorrt")
- cuda_major: CUDA major version (e.g., "12")
- version: Package version (e.g., "10.0.0.1")
"""
pyproject = _read_pyproject_toml()
trt_config = pyproject.get("tool", {}).get("tensorrt", {})
return {
"base_name": trt_config.get("base-name", "tensorrt"),
"cuda_major": trt_config.get("cuda-major", "12"),
"version": trt_config.get("version") or pyproject.get("project", {}).get("version", "0.0.0"),
}
def _compute_package_names(trt_config, wheel_type):
"""
Compute the distribution and import package names based on wheel type.
Args:
trt_config: Dict with base_name, cuda_major, version
wheel_type: One of "binding", "binding_standalone", "libs", "frontend"
Returns:
tuple: (distribution_name, import_name)
- distribution_name: Name for pip install (e.g., "tensorrt_cu12_bindings")
- import_name: Name for Python import (e.g., "tensorrt_bindings")
"""
base_name = trt_config["base_name"]
cuda_major = trt_config["cuda_major"]
if wheel_type == "binding_standalone":
# Standalone bindings: tensorrt_cu12_bindings / tensorrt_bindings
return f"{base_name}_cu{cuda_major}_bindings", f"{base_name}_bindings"
elif wheel_type == "libs":
# Libs wheel: tensorrt_cu12_libs / tensorrt
return f"{base_name}_cu{cuda_major}_libs", base_name
elif wheel_type == "frontend":
# Frontend wheel: tensorrt_cu12 / tensorrt
return f"{base_name}_cu{cuda_major}", base_name
else:
# Non-standalone binding or default: tensorrt / tensorrt
return base_name, base_name
def _get_wheel_tags(config_settings):
"""
Extract wheel tags from config_settings.
Returns:
tuple: (python_tag, plat_name) or (None, None) if not specified
"""
config_settings = config_settings or {}
python_tag = config_settings.get("python-tag")
plat_name = config_settings.get("plat-name")
return python_tag, plat_name
def _get_wheel_type(config_settings):
"""
Get the wheel type from config_settings.
Returns one of: "binding", "binding_standalone", "libs", "frontend", or None
Returns None if not set (passthrough mode - no dynamic naming).
"""
config_settings = config_settings or {}
return config_settings.get("wheel-type")
def _update_pyproject_for_build(dist_name, import_name):
"""
Update pyproject.toml in-place with computed package name and version.
This allows setuptools to pick up the correct dynamic values.
We modify the file temporarily during the build process.
Args:
dist_name: Distribution name (for pip install)
import_name: Import name (for Python import)
"""
pyproject_path = Path("pyproject.toml")
content = pyproject_path.read_text()
# Update name field - replace placeholder or any existing name
content = content.replace(
'name = "build-backend-placeholder"',
f'name = "{dist_name}"'
)
# Update packages.find.include to use import name
content = content.replace(
'include = ["build-backend-placeholder"]',
f'include = ["{import_name}*"]'
)
pyproject_path.write_text(content)
def build_wheel(wheel_directory, config_settings=None, metadata_directory=None):
"""
Build a wheel with TensorRT-specific customizations.
This is the main PEP 517 hook for building wheels. It:
1. If wheel-type config setting is set: computes package name dynamically and updates pyproject.toml
2. Applies custom python/platform tags if specified via config settings
3. Builds the wheel using setuptools
4. Moves the final wheel to the output directory
Config settings (passed via --config-setting):
wheel-type: Type of wheel being built (binding, binding_standalone, libs, frontend)
python-tag: Python tag for the wheel (e.g., cp312)
plat-name: Platform tag for the wheel (e.g., linux_x86_64)
When wheel-type is not set, this acts as a passthrough to setuptools,
only applying wheel tags if specified.
"""
wheel_type = _get_wheel_type(config_settings)
# Only do dynamic naming if wheel type is specified
if wheel_type:
trt_config = _get_tensorrt_config()
dist_name, import_name = _compute_package_names(trt_config, wheel_type)
_update_pyproject_for_build(dist_name, import_name)
# Get wheel tags
python_tag, plat_name = _get_wheel_tags(config_settings)
# Build config_settings to pass wheel tags directly to setuptools
build_config = dict(config_settings or {})
# Pass wheel options via --build-option (setuptools.build_meta convention)
build_options = []
if python_tag:
build_options.append(f"--python-tag={python_tag}")
if plat_name:
build_options.append(f"--plat-name={plat_name}")
if build_options:
# Merge with any existing build options
existing = build_config.get("--build-option", [])
if isinstance(existing, str):
existing = [existing]
build_config["--build-option"] = list(existing) + build_options
# Build wheel using setuptools to a temporary directory first
# This avoids conflicts with existing wheels in the output directory
with tempfile.TemporaryDirectory() as tmp_wheel_dir:
wheel_filename = _setuptools_build_wheel(
tmp_wheel_dir,
config_settings=build_config,
metadata_directory=metadata_directory
)
wheel_path = Path(tmp_wheel_dir) / wheel_filename
# Move the final wheel to the output directory
final_wheel_path = Path(wheel_directory) / wheel_path.name
# Remove existing wheel if present (handles parallel build conflicts)
if final_wheel_path.exists():
final_wheel_path.unlink()
shutil.move(str(wheel_path), str(final_wheel_path))
return final_wheel_path.name
# Re-export other hooks from setuptools.build_meta
__all__ = [
"build_wheel",
"build_sdist",
"get_requires_for_build_wheel",
"get_requires_for_build_sdist",
"prepare_metadata_for_build_wheel",
]
